Frequently Asked Questions about Hamilton County

How much are Studio apartments in Hamilton County?

There are currently 290 Studio Apartments in Hamilton County with rent ranges from $645 to $4,044 with an average price of $1,338.

What is the current price range for One Bedroom Hamilton County Apartments for rent?

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Hamilton County ranges from $250 to $4,335 with an average monthly rent of $1,512.

What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Hamilton County cost?

The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Hamilton County range from $775 to $7,640.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,965.

How expensive are Hamilton County Three Bedroom Apartments?

There are currently 413 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Hamilton County on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$899 to $18,000 - averaging $2,157 for the location.
